It seems video preview (H.264 payload based on the SIP Early Media protocol) is still causing a lot of issues
and makes it complicated to use 3CX combined with Intercoms such as 2N IP devices or any other device.
Would be nice if the 3CX Android Softphone App would be able to support either one way or two way
video /audio preview. (initiating and/or receiving).
Typical Intercom Silent Video Preview (H.264) Scenario, requiring UX with up to five buttons you can press in the app:
a) Intercom (or 3CX softphone) initiates a SIP call with early media support such as 2N software.
(would be nice to have special test option to initiate a call with or without an early media request
from within the 3CX app for testing purposes) the 3CX app would then mimic any intercom.
b) 3CX Android app, receives incoming call from intercom
c) 3CX Android app user , presses "Preview Video Only button" without accepting the call, a session is established
with incoming video and audio oneway only. (no outbound video, no outbound audio, nothing!)
d) 3CX Android app user ,after checking the video image, accepts an incoming one-way Video and two-way audio call by pressing "Green phone button"
e) Default: two way audio session is established and video one way ( video from Intercom device to 3CX softphone)
f) Session established: there is an option to turn on Video on the softphone; User presses "Activate My Camera button", now there is two way video.
g) Press the "Open Door Button" : configurable DTMF sequence transmitted.
h) future idea: perform a configurable simple fixed (string based) REST API call to an integration endpoint (string) ; Example send
date/time to your own API for door open audit logging. "Action XYZ button"
If these "button" features would be available it may save a lot of time and effort debugging intercom scenario's as you could simply
start testing with two smartphones and thus make sure the server is properly configured
Is there anything on the 3CX APP roadmap that would enable users to test the above standard scenario at some point in time?
